§ · Frameworks

Named ideas worth stealing.

00:24 concept

One Problem Alignment

Every post, lead magnet, and email must trace back to the one core pain point your offer solves. Visualized as a pyramid with the problem at the base and the offer at the apex.

Steal for any content strategy audit or editorial calendar review
00:08 model

4-Layer Revenue Pyramid

  1. One Problem Alignment
  2. Create Better & More Lead Magnet Content
  3. ManyChat to Collect Emails
  4. Welcome Sequence to Offer

The four sequential layers from raw content to revenue. Each layer is useless without the one below it being solid first.

Steal for Instagram strategy presentation or client onboarding framework
05:35 concept

Trial Reels Double-Post

Post the identical reel to your main feed and to Trial Reels simultaneously. Trial Reels reach cold audiences and their interactions train the algorithm toward buyer-intent profiles.

Steal for any platform with a test or draft audience distribution mode
14:10 model

80/20 Welcome Sequence

  1. 80% pure value emails
  2. 20% offer mention emails

The trust curve built by over-delivering earns explicit pitch permission. Most service sales happen on day 4–6 of the sequence.

§ 05 · For Joe

The four moves that turn Instagram posts into booked clients.

WHAT TO LEARN

Revenue from Instagram has nothing to do with view count — it comes from aligning every post to one buyer problem, then building a mechanical path from comment to email to sale.

  • Picking one problem and never deviating trains the algorithm to find your actual buyers, not just curious scrollers.
  • Lead magnet calls-to-action work as a volume lever: adding 2–3 LM-CTA posts per week to an existing schedule compounds lead flow predictably without requiring better content.
  • Posting the same reel to both your main feed and Trial Reels simultaneously can nearly double your lead count; Trial Reels reach exclusively cold audiences and teach the algorithm which type of person engages with your content.
  • Instagram Trial Reels can be recycled after a waiting period by slightly resizing the video and altering metadata — the algorithm treats it as a distinct piece of content.
  • ManyChat simplest flow — a comment triggers a DM with a link — consistently outperforms elaborate automation trees for service businesses; complexity adds friction without adding conversion.
  • A welcome email sequence of 4–30 daily emails that over-delivers on the lead magnet promise earns pitch permission; most service clients book between day 4 and day 6.
  • Most email subscribers do not know what your paid offer is until you explicitly tell them — stating your offer inside the welcome sequence is not aggressive, it is required for the system to close.
